Abstract

The main goal of the paper is to present a general model theoretic framework to understand a result of Shalev on probabilistically finite nilpotent groups. We prove that a suitable group where the equation [x_1,...,x_k]=1 holds on a wide set, in a model theoretic sense, is an extension of a nilpotent group of class less than k by a uniformly locally finite group. In particular, this result applies to amenable groups, as well as to suitable model-theoretic families of definable groups such as groups in simple theories and groups with finitely satisfiable generics.
